Solve for x: x /6−y/3= 1
SHOW WORK

[tex]\dfrac x6 - \dfrac y3 =1\\\\\\\implies \dfrac x6 - \dfrac{2y}6 = 1\\\\\\\implies \dfrac{x-2y}6 =1\\\\\\\implies x -2y =6\\\\\\\implies x =6+2y\\\\\\\implies x = 2(3 +y)[/tex]
